It's been obvious for a while now that the latest SUVs and pickup trucks, with their absurdly high front hoods, were deadly to pedestrians. But Justin Tyndall did the math to prove it.
"A 10 cm increase in front-end height causes a 22% increase in pedestrian fatality risk."
"A cap on front-end vehicle heights of 1.25 m would reduce annual US pedestrian deaths by [an estimated] 509."
